As a brightening agent, vitamin C is one of the most widely sought-after ingredients in skincare. Where other topical vitamin C products have been capped at 8 to 20 percent concentrations so as not to irritate the skin, Vivier’s newly launched Serum 30 safely ups the dosage. Through its patented IntraDermal System (IDS)—which allows for optimal comfort, absorption and results—the serum combines two distinctive forms of vitamin C for a powerful 30 percent concentration overall.
